1. Apply for a Personal Loan
If you have a steady income and a good credit score, applying for a personal loan might be your best bet. Many financial institutions offer personal loans with competitive interest rates and flexible repayment terms. Research different lenders and compare their offers to find the one that suits you best.
2. Seek Assistance from Friends or Family
Another option is reaching out to your friends or family for help. Discuss your financial situation openly and honestly, explaining why you need the money and when you’d be able to repay it. Creating a formal agreement and setting up a repayment plan can help maintain transparency and ensure a smooth transaction.
3. Explore Crowdfunding Platforms
In recent years, crowdfunding has become a popular way to raise funds for various purposes. Create a compelling campaign on reputable crowdfunding platforms to share your story and goals with potential contributors. Make sure to offer attractive perks or rewards to entice people to support your cause and reach your funding target.
4. Consider a Side Hustle
If time permits, taking up a side hustle can be an effective way to generate additional income. Evaluate your skills and interests to identify opportunities; whether it’s freelance work, tutoring, or selling products online, every extra bit of money adds up. Dedicate time and effort to your side hustle and watch your bank account grow.
5. Sell Unwanted Items
We all have belongings lying around that we no longer need or use. Gather these items and consider selling them through online marketplaces or organizing a garage sale. Not only will you declutter your space, but you’ll also accumulate funds towards your target sum.
6. Cut Back on Expenses
Take a close look at your expenses and identify areas where you can cut back. Analyze your budget, eliminate unnecessary subscriptions or memberships, and reduce discretionary spending. By prioritizing your financial goals, you can redirect funds towards your 20,000 Euro target.
